Brian Cassell joins Stevens Construction as chief financial officer
TelAve News/10906089
FORT MYERS, Fla. - TelAve -- Stevens Construction, Inc. has named Brian Cassell as chief financial officer (CFO), announced Mark Stevens, president.
As CFO, Cassell is responsible for the strategic and operational leadership of the company's financial functions, including accounting, finance, treasury, financial planning and analysis, budgeting, forecasting, tax strategy, compliance, internal controls and risk management.
In addition, Cassell provides executive oversight of Stevens Construction's information technology functions, ensuring financial strategy, operational infrastructure, technology initiatives and workforce planning remain aligned with the company's business objectives.
"As we move into this next phase of growth, we're excited to have Brian join our team," said Stevens. "His depth of financial and operational experience will be a tremendous asset as Stevens Construction continues to grow. Brian brings the strategic perspective and leadership to strengthen our operations, support our team and ensure we're well positioned for the opportunities ahead."

Cassell brings three decades of experience leading finance, operations and strategic growth for global and regional manufacturing, construction and technology firms. Cassell has a proven track record of driving revenue growth, improving profitability, strengthening financial reporting and building high-performing teams. His expertise in capital management, governance, operational excellence and strategic planning will help support Stevens Construction's continued growth.
Cassell earned a master's degree in business administration from the University of Notre Dame's Mendoza College of Business and a bachelor's degree in accounting and business management from Asbury University. He also completed executive education in negotiation strategies and influence skills at the University of Michigan and holds a Six Sigma green belt certification. For the last three years, he has served on the board of directors for the Children's Advocacy Center of Southwest Florida.

About Stevens Construction, Inc.
With offices in Fort Myers and Orlando, Stevens Construction specializes in providing construction management, general contracting, and consulting services to clients and design professionals. Other services include site and design team selection, budgeting, project scheduling, permitting, cost and quality control, and warranty service. With more than $1B of commercial construction completed, Stevens Construction builds commercial, healthcare and hospitality facilities.
